 The final installment in the Poppy War Trilogy. A young girl fighting a war on multiple fronts: civil, foreign, mental, spiritual and physical. 

Pros: 
✅ historical parallels 
✅ impactful themes of war and the crimes and brutality that follow it 
✅ strong atmosphere of pain and suffering across an entire nation 

Cons: 
❌ very little character development. they mainly felt like chess pieces moved around or added to progress the war 
❌ massive pacing issues... no down time! it's just war, war, war, war. no time to build any kind of connections 
❌ magical elements were virutally useless and lead to nothing SPOILER:
So much hype for the Triad just for them to all get defeaeted at the top of a mountain byt eh same army their thought they could defeat with just the three of them... so incredibly disappointed and what a waste of time throughout the entire trilogy.
 
❌ a well written unlikeable character but who is incredibly infuriating in her stupidity! She somehow always ends up in the same situation over and over and over again... I needed something new to happen at least once. 

What I want to end this review with is that I am glad I read the trilogy because the themes it brings up are important and to have them in a "fantasy" setting lets the author explore them more deeply and with less limitations, but I also think this trilogy tried to do too much theme building and not enough story and character development. Perhaps R.F. Kuang is not the author for me. I will still read her standalone Babel though and find out!

I don't know where to begin. Kuang is an excellent writer and creator of characters. I fell in love with Chen Kitay and his bond with Rin was the most moving aspect of the story. Rin's ending felt fitting, inevitable, and unsettling. It feels so cruel that Nezha is the only surviving character out of the dozen or so we came to love. He was so well written, but I wish more was done with his character ultimately. The third installment felt so very rushed and frustrating at times. I'll be thinking about this for a while.

I tend to be able to finish a book of this length within 2 days... this one took me a little over a month. This book (really this series) demands your attention and emotions and everything you have to give to it. Every second I was not reading this book I was thinking about it and the things it was telling me to look at and observe in the world. So many POC have such a similar story for their country and this makes you not only feel incredibly seen and understood but makes you take a good hard look at how the things that happened to your country left such long lasting scars in you and your family and how you responded. This isn't a book/series for just anyone. It is a very difficult read emotionally and mentally. I took breaks because it would begin to feel so overwhelming, but man was it worth every second. Rin is not easy to love but man so I hold her so close to my heart. I will for sure be going back for a more in depth reread at some point. For not I still feel the weight of this book on my chest and will probably be constantly thinking back to it's themes over the next few months.
